Dhunseri Tea & Industries Limited is an India-based holding company. The Company and its subsidiaries are primarily engaged in the business of cultivation, manufacture and sale of tea and macadamia nuts and other allied services relating to the plantation sector across various geographical locations. Its segments include India and the Rest of the World. The India segment covers cultivation, manufacture, and sale of tea from India and other allied services relating to the plantation sector. The Rest of the World segment primarily covers the business of cultivation, manufacture, and sale of tea and macadamia nuts from Malawi and other allied services relating to the plantation sector. It has over 12 tea estates in Assam, India. It also has around two tea estates in Malawi, East Africa, where plantations of tea and macadamia are being carried out. Its subsidiaries include Dhunseri Petrochem & Tea Pte Ltd, Kawalazi Estate Co. Ltd., and Chiwale Estate Management Services Ltd., and others.
